What is prds system?

PRDS: Pressure Reducing and DeSuperheating System. It is a combination of Control Valve for the pressure reduction purpose & atomizing nozzles, through which water is sprayed into steam for reducing the temperature.

What is the function of a desuperheater?

The primary function of a desuperheater is to lower the temperature of superheated steam or other vapors. This temperature reduction is accomplished as a result of the process vapor being brought into direct contact with another liquid such as water. The injected water is then evaporated.

How does a steam pressure reducing valve work?

Steam reducing pressure valves are valves that precise control the downstream pressure of steam and automatically adjust the amount of valve opening to allow the pressure to remain unchanged even when the flow rate fluctuates by pistons, springs or diaphragms.

How does desuperheater control the exit temperature from superheater?

When the desuperheater is operational, a measured amount of water is added to the superheated steam via a mixing arrangement within the desuperheater. As it enters the desuperheater, the cooling water evaporates by absorbing heat from the superheated steam. Consequently, the temperature of the steam is reduced.

What is an Attemperator in boiler?

Attemperator is a spray of water to reduce the steam temperature that is limited as per the operational requirements. An Attemporator spray reduces the steam temperature in the superheater zones of a boiler so as to maintain around 535-540 degree centigrade temperature at the inlet of the steam turbine.

What is the function of pressure reducing valve?

Pressure reducing valves (PRV) lower the downstream pressure to match the setpoint, opening as the pressure falls and closing as it rises. These mechanical valves employ a spring against a diaphragm or piston as the control element which makes them simple and reliable in operation.

How does the reducing valve work?

It is often referred to as a pressure regulator. The valve simply uses spring pressure against a diaphragm to open the valve. When the outlet pressure drops below the set point of the valve, the spring pressure overcomes the outlet pressure and forces the valve stem downward, opening the valve.

What is ESD boiler?

The original External Superheater ‘D’ (ESD) type of boiler used a primary and secondary superheater located after the main generating tube bank . An attemperator located in the combustion air path was used to control the steam temperature.
